Показать сообщение отдельно
  #1 (permalink)  
Старый 03.12.2014, 12:02
Новичок на форуме
Отправить личное сообщение для Hottsb Посмотреть профиль Найти все сообщения от Hottsb
 
Регистрация: 03.12.2014
Сообщений: 1

Помогите отредактировать Web-сервер на Arduino
Всем добрый день!
Столкнулся с небольшой трудностью в создании Web странички на Arduino, т.к. познания в JavaScript и HTML не велики. Вобщем задача такая, вывести на web страничку 4 TrackBar (ползунка), и подцепить к ним глобальные переменные, которые бы управляли яркостью светодиодов подключённых к Arduino. Всё бы хорошо, но как только я перемещаю ползунок и отправляю данные на Arduino, он сразу сбрасывается и устанавливается в 0, вот хочется как то задать переменные "value" чтобы они сохраняли позицию ползунка. И ещё чтобы отправлять запрос на дуинку мне требуется нажимать кнопку отправить, а возможно ли чтобы при изменении ползунка, данные отправлялся автоматический, мне знакомый сказал это можно сделать на JavaScript, ранее я использовал только HTML, вот что я имею сейчас:

Код:
 bfill.emit_p(PSTR(
     
    "<title>Яркость</title>"
   "<meta http-equiv='content-type' content='text/html; charset=UTF-8'/>"
   "<p>тестирование</p>"
   "<form action='led1'>"
   "<input type='range' name='y' min ='0' max='255' step ='5' value ='n[1]'/> <input type='submit' value = 'LED1'/>"
   "</form>"
    "<form action='led2'>"
   "<input type='range' name='y' min ='0' max='255' step ='5' value ='n[2]'/> <input type='submit'  value = 'LED2'/>"
   "</form>"
    "<form action='led3'>"
   "<input type='range' name='y' min ='0' max='255' step ='5' value ='n[3]'/> <input type='submit'  value = 'LED3'/>"
   "</form>"
    "<form action='led4'>"
   "<input type='range' name='y' min ='0' max='255' step ='5' value ='n[4]'/> <input type='submit' value = 'LED4' />"
   "</form>"
    ));
Вот что мы имеем на страничке:
Ответить с цитированием